1、 下面哪个命令的语法正确?
A.mail newmail -f
B.who -u-m
C.-u who
D.mail -f newmail
2.下面哪个命令可以查看user01用户何时登录?
A.who am i
B.who
C.finger everyone
D.finger user01
3.面哪个命令可以查看pwd命令的man页面?
A. catman -w pwd
B. man pwd
C. man -k pwd
D. man -f pwd
4.某个命令帮助的具体描述信息,应该在man帮助文档的哪个部分?
A.Syntax
B.Purpose
C.Description
D.Implementation
5.下面哪个不是有效的文件名?
A.1
B.-myfile
<_file
< file
6.下面哪个命令可以查看当前所在的路径?
A.cd
B.ls
C.pwd
D.ls -al
7.下面对ls -l命令列出的信息描述正确的是哪个?
A.当前目录下的隐藏文件
B.当前目录的父目录路径
C.用户主目录下的所有文件
D.当前目录下的文件的权限信息
8.下面哪些是相对路径?(多选)
A. ../limhai/file
B. /tmp/file1
C. /.profile
D. ./.profile
9.下面哪些命令可以用来阅读文件?(多选)
A.cat
B.pg
<
D.wc
10.若umask参数为022数值,下面哪些描述是正确的?(多选)
A.创建的文件默认权限是644
B.创建的目录默认权限是644
C.创建的目录默认权限是755
D.创建的文件默认权限是755
11.若umask参数为027数值,下面哪些描述是正确的?(多选)
A.创建的文件默认权限是640
B.创建的目录默认权限是755
C.创建的目录默认权限是750
D.创建的文件默认权限是644
12.file文件原访问权限属性是755,如何去掉owner和other的执行权限?
A.chmod uo-x file
B.chmod g-x file
C.chmod ug-x file
D.chmod uo+x file
13.两个用户都属于salary组,其中一个用户想访问另一个用户的某个文件,这个文件的权限是706,下面描述正确的是哪个?
A.只能读取这个文件
B.不能访问这个文件
C.没有限制
D.可读可写,但是不能执行这个文件
14.vi编辑器,键入哪个字符可进入编辑模式?(多选)
A. a
B. x
C. i
D. dd
15.vi编辑器,撤销前面的命令操作是哪个键?
A. q
B. u
C. J
D. $
16.哪个命令退出vi编辑器,并保存数据?(多选)
A. q!
B. yy
C. ZZ
D.:wq
E.Quit
F.!save
17.vi编辑器,用?在文件中查关键词,下面描述正确的是哪个?
A. 从文件开头开始查到文件尾部
B. 从文件尾部开始查到文件开头
C. 从光标所在的位置向下查
D. 从光标所在的位置向上查
18.下面描述哪些是正确的?(多选)
A.多重命令,用符号“ ; ”分开
B.输出重定向符号为“ > ”或“ >> ”
C.AIX默认用的shell是ksh
D.管道(pipe)把前面命令的输出作为后面命令的输入
19.哪个是用以追加输出重定向的符号?
A.>>
B.>
C.\
D.<
20.对通配符描述正确的有哪些?(多选)
A.?g? 通配中间字符为g的共三个字符的字符串
B. *s 通配以s结束
的任意字符串
C.[3-6] 表示在3到6之间的4个数字任意一个
D.[!k] 表示除了k字母外的任意字符
21.如何查看终端类型?
23.用户主目录是/home/limhai,下面命令的结果?echo ‘$HOME’ is my “$HOME” directory
A.‘$HOME’ is my “$HOME” directory
B./home/limhai is my “$HOME” directory
C.$HOME is my /home/limhai directory
D.$HOME is my $HOME directory
24.下列对shell脚本描述错误的是哪个?
A.shell脚本文件是文本文件,可用vi编辑
B.shell脚本文件是二进制文件
C.脚本执行后返回的代码0表示命令执行成功
D.给shell脚本添加可执行权限后,可直接执行脚本
25.列出一台机器上所有进程的命令?
A.ps -ef
B.who
C.date
26.下列哪些描述是正确的?
A.命令后加&,将在后台运行进程
B.jobs 命令查看后台进程
C.普通用户也可以kill其他普通用户的作业任务
27.一个进程在后台挂起,如何让它在前台继续运行?
A.fg
B.bg
C.<ctrl+z>
D.<ctrl+c>
28.如何使得在用户注销后,仍在继续运行进程?
C.fg ls –R / > file
D.bg ls –R / > file
29.下列对ps 命令描述正确的是哪个?
A.ps -ef 可以查看除了内核进程外的所有进程的状态
B.ps aux 可以查看系统的daemon进程的状态
C.ps 命令不能查看到系统的daemon进程的状态
30.假如当前目录不在PATH中,如何执行当前目录的可执行文件foo?
A. foo
B. ../foo
C. ./foo
D. /foo
简答题
1.如下一个文件,如何用cat命令分别做到如下要求:
1)、把file1的文件内容定向到filea 文件,把错误输出定向到fileb 文件?
2)、把file1的文件内容和错误输出都定向到filea 文件?
3)、只是把file1的文件内容定向到filea文件,而且错误的输出不显示到屏幕,自动扔掉
cat file1 > filea 2>fileb
cat file1 > filea
cat file1 > 2> /dev/null
2.依次执行如下命令后,最后x的返回值是多少?
$x=60
$ksh
$x=50
$export x
$<ctrl+d>
$echp $x
?x
3.依次执行如下命令,x的返回值各是多少?
$export x=60
$ksh
$export x=50
$echo $x
?x
$exit
shell脚本返回执行结果
$echo $x
?x
4.依次执行如下命令,x的返回值各是多少?
$x=60
$exportx
$x=50
$ksh
$echo $x
?x
5.系统管理员要执行find / -name “core*这条命令
1)、想放在后台执行该怎么做? fine / -name "core*" > fine.out 2> /dev/null &
2)、如果正在前台执行,想把它切换到后台执行该怎么做? ctrl-z, bg %n
3)、如何查看这条命令是否正在后台执行? jobs
4)、想把后台的任务切换到前台又是如何执行? fg %n
6.登录一
个系统后,
用( who )命令查看当前有哪些用户在线?
用( date )命令查看系统的时间日期?
用( wall )命令向在线用户发广播消息?
用( write )命令给某个在线用户发消息? write user01
如果要退出系统,用( exit.logout )命令?
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论